Noun [Ancient Greek]

IPA: /skɔ̌ːps/, /skops/, /skops/, /skɔ̌ːps/ (note: 5ᵗʰ BCE Attic), /skops/ (note: 1ˢᵗ CE Egyptian), /skops/ (note: 4ᵗʰ CE Koine), /skops/ (note: 10ᵗʰ CE Byzantine), /skops/ (note: 15ᵗʰ CE Constantinopolitan)
Etymology: Usually connected to the root Proto-Indo-European *speḱ- (“to look”), whence also σκέπτομαι (sképtomai). Beekes claims that this is Pre-Greek based on an assumption that it could be related to the Macedonian dialectal γώψ (gṓps, “jackdaw”).
